Abstract

The purpose of this research was to analyze
the effect of adding jamu lempuyang into the chicken
feed toward crude fiber digestibility, fat digestibility,
protein biological value and nitrogen retention of
free-range chicken. This research used experimental
method. The design used in this study was completely
randomized design (CRD) with 4 treatments and 5
replications. The treatment in this study consisted of
P0 without Zingiber (as a control), P1 Zingiber
0.15%, P2 Zingiber 0.30% , and P3 Zingiber 0.45%.
The variables measured were crude fiber digestibility,
fat digestibility, protein biological value and nitrogen
retention of free-range chicken. The data were
analyzed by using analysis of variance (ANOVA).
When there was a significant effect, it was further
tested by using Least Significant Difference (LSD).
Based on the research, the effect of adding jamu
lempuyang into the feed was not significant (P>0.05)
on crude fiber digestibility, protein biological value
and nitrogen retention of free-range chicken. On the
other hand, the effect of adding jamu lempuyang into
the feed had significant effect (P<0.05) on fat
digestibility. Jamu lempuyang on free-range chicken
was less effective in increasing crude digestibility
protein biological value and nitrogen retention but
more effective to increase fat digestibility of free-range chicken.
